And certainly did We send Moses with Our signs to Pharaoh and his establishment, and he said, "Indeed, I am the messenger of the Lord of the worlds." 46 Yet when he brought forth Clear Signs from Us, then lo, they burst into laughter. 47 even though each sign We showed them was greater than the previous one. We afflicted them with torment so that they might return [to the right path]. 48 And they said, 'Sorcerer, pray to thy Lord for us by the covenant He has made with thee, and surely we shall be right-guided.' 49 But when We removed from them the chastisement, lo! they broke the pledge. 50 And Pharaoh proclaimed among his people: “My people, do I not have dominion over Egypt, and are these streams not flowing beneath me? Can't you see? 51 Am I not better than this contemptible man who can hardly make his meaning clear: 52 Why were then no bracelets of gold shed upon him from above, or angels sent down as a retinue with him?" 53 Thus he [Fir'aun (Pharaoh)] befooled and misled his people, and they obeyed him. Verily, they were ever a people who were Fasiqun (rebellious, disobedient to Allah). 54 So when they vexed Us, We took vengeance on them, and We drowned them all. 55 And We made them a thing past, and an example for those after (them). 56
